Element of Crime
Only true fans know how many albums Element of Crime has released in the last 30 years: roughly 15, or nearly 25 if we count the live albums. Since it was founded in 1985, the Berlin band led by singer, guitarist, trumpeter, songwriter, novelist and scriptwriter Sven Regener has stood for intelligent texts set to many-sided and surprising music. The subjects are pretty varied, and always a bit sentimental: the songs are about love and alcohol, the horizon and Berlin – and occasionally about the little town of Delmenhorst. The band’s 30-year history also shows that Element of Crime are at their best on stage – as can be seen and heard at their first gig in the Elbphilharmonie Grand Hall.
Performers
Element of Crime
Sven Regener vocals, guitar, trumpet
Jakob Ilja guitar
Richard Pappik drums, percussion, harmonica
David Young bass
